How we build these reports

Every PrepRadar scout report is drafted by our AI pipeline from verified source data (247Sports, ESPN, On3, Rivals, team rosters, monitored social accounts) and then structured into sections covering the player's background, playing style, strengths, areas to watch, comparisons, and recruitment outlook. Reports are refreshed on a rolling schedule four times a day, so this feed updates continuously.
